Two horizontal forces act on a 2.0 kg chopping block that can slide over a frictionless kitchen counter, which lies in an xy plane. One force is \(\vec{F}_{1}=(3.0 \mathrm{N}) \hat{\mathrm{i}}+(4.0 \mathrm{N}) \hat{\mathrm{j}}\). Find the acceleration of the chopping block in unit-vector notation when the other force is
(a) \(\vec{F}_{2}=(-3.0 \mathrm{N}) \hat{\mathrm{i}}+(-4.0 \mathrm{N}) \hat{\mathrm{j}}\),
(b) \(\vec{F}_{2}=(-3.0 \mathrm{N}) \hat{\mathrm{i}}+(4.0 \mathrm{N}) \hat{\mathrm{j}}\), and
(c) \(\vec{F}_{2}=(3.0 \mathrm{N}) \hat{\mathrm{i}}+(-4.0 \mathrm{N}) \hat{\mathrm{j}}\).
